摘要
为筛选出优质的甜瓜种质资源,对吉林省蔬菜花卉科学研究院现存的65份甜瓜种质资源进行遗传多样性分析与评价,对其果实主要性状进行调查统计、数据分析.通过对果实性状进行遗传分析,发现其变异系数的变化范围为16.62%~59.25%,多样性指数变化范围为4.11~4.38;对甜瓜果实性状进行相关性分析,有22对性状间呈极显著相关,有2对性状间呈显著相关;对甜瓜资源的果实性状进行主成分分析,在累积贡献率为84.19%处,筛选出了5个主成分因子,分别为糖酸因子、质量因子、表型因子、果柄因子、品质因子;对甜瓜果实性状进行聚类分析,在欧式距离12.5处将65份甜瓜种质资源聚为三大类群;通过综合评价得分计算,筛选出了10份果实性状较好的种质资源,分别为卡加里麝香、Q196、拉贾斯坦蜜瓜、FY39、斑比洋香瓜、Q174、Q171、浓郁的甜味132、蜜露、Q163,他们的品质优良、单果质量适中.
Abstract
To screen out high-quality melon germplasm resources,genetic diversity analysis and evaluation were conduct-ed on 65 existing melon germplasm resources at Jilin Vegetable and Flower Science Research Institute.The investiga-tion,statistics,and data analysis were conducted on the main fruit traits.Through genetic analysis of the fruit,it was found that the coefficient of variation ranged from 16.62% to 59.25%,and the diversity index ranged from 4.11 to 4.38.Correlation analysis was conducted on the fruit traits of cantaloupe,with 22 traits showing extremely significant correla-tion and 2 traits showing significant correlation.Principal component analysis was conducted on the fruit traits of melon resources,and five principal component factors were selected at a cumulative contribution rate of 84.19%,namely sugar acid factor,mass factor,phenotype factor,fruit stem factor,and quality factor.Cluster analysis was conducted on the fruit traits of cantaloupe,and 65 cantaloupes were clustered into three major groups at a Euclidean distance of 12.5.Through comprehensive evaluation score calculation,10 varieties with good traits were selected,including Kagari Musk,Q196,Rajasthan Honey Melon,FY39,Bambi Western Melon,Q174,Q171,Rich Sweetness 132,Milu,Q163,which had excellent quality and moderate fruit mass.
